These days most folks hop on their mobile device to search for what they are looking for using Google Maps, Yelp or other online Apps that help them obtain reviews and business information.

According to a study back in 2013, there were well over 10 billion searches performed every month. Those numbers have most probably doubled or tripled during that time and are only going to get larger. Of those billions, more than 50 percent of those searches were for local information. Half of the local searches began without having a certain business name in mind with folks searching for a service or product that they needed help with online.
